Dry-brush Sole Cleaner
This Dry-brush sole cleaner cleans shoe soles without water, ltprimarily utilizes the rotation of the brush to remove dust particles from thesoles, preventing contaminants from entering the cleaning area. lt is widelyused in locations requiring high cleanliness.

Working Principle
Dry brush sole cleaners typically use a motor to drive a wear-resistant brush. When a shoe sole is placed on the brush, the brush rubs against the sole, removing dust, dirt, and other impurities from the sole into a dust collection tray.
Dry-brush sole cleaner Structural Features
The brush is made of wear-resistant material, such as in automatic sole cleaners. It offers excellent cleaning performance, durability, and multiple reusability.
Support: The support and housing are constructed of high-quality, thickened stainless steel, offering excellent corrosion resistance and good resistance to intergranular corrosion. Safety handrails are installed along the edges of the machine. The sleek, clean lines and finely polished metal housing create a stylish and elegant look.
Sensing Device: Typically equipped with a sensitive infrared sensor, it automatically activates when a person approaches and automatically stops when they leave, effectively saving energy and extending service life.
